MEDIEVAL SILVER RING WITH FIVE-POINTED STAR Ca. AD 1400 - 1600. A silver ring with a flat hoop and a large bezel shaped as a scalloped disc, engraved with a central five-pointed star enclosing a wheel motif. Each space between the arms of the star and the adjacent lobes is filled with incised decoration. Size: D:18.14mm / US: 8 / UK: P 1/2; Weight: 5g Provenance: Private UK collection; previously acquired on the Holland art market in the 1990s.
